About Imbabura:

Imbabura is a 4000+ meter extinct volcano near the town of Ibarra north of Quito. It is a very long hike to a fun scramble along the crater rim. The views of the countryside are beautiful. This is a good acclimatization hike for people interested in the higher 5000 meters peaks.
Nearest town or city: Ibarra
Directions: Take a bus to Ibarra from Quito's Terminal Terrestre. Take either another bus or a taxi to the village of La Esperanza high on the slopes of Imbabura. There is a nice hostel called Casa Aida, and Imbabura can be climbed in a long day from the front door by the physically very fit.
